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i’s Conduct A Successful Visit to Four Countries in SEA

Date:2021-01-18
Place:

    At the invitation of State Counselor and Foreign Minister Daw Aung San Suu Kyi of Myanmar, Foreign Minister Retno Lestari Priansari Marsudi of Indonesia, Second Foreign Minister Dato Seri Paduka Haji Erywan bin Pehin Datu Pekerma Jaya Haji Mohd Yusof of Brunei, and Secretary of Foreign Affairs Teodoro Lopez Locsin of the Philippines, Wang had paid official visits to the four countries from last Monday(January 11th) to Saturday(January 16th ). Just one day after wrapping up an intensive visit to five African countries in six days, Chinese State Councilor and Foreign Minister Wang Yi embarked on his second overseas journey in the New Year to Southeast Asia on Monday (11th January).

    Analysts from China and ASEAN countries firmly believe that Minister Wang Yi’s visit will not only help consolidate China-ASEAN friendship but also bring plenty of mutual benefits to both parties. During the meaningful visit, Minister Wang Yi had discussed with heads of government in these countries about the cooperation on vaccination. In addition, China and Myanmar sign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) on Sunday to conduct feasibility study of a railway linking Mandalay, the country's second largest city in Myanmar's central region, with Kyaukphyu, the major town in Myanmar's Rakhine state.
